blow the gaff
In real, traceable use. Part of the curated seed collection; community review is coming.
Sense 1
Meaning · English
To disclose a secret.
Register: slang
Examples
But, my child, if Geoffrey is to be got out at this immature stage it blows the gaff completely. Half of the crowd will vanish, including all the worst, and we shall have no proof at all of the real depths of the conspiracy.
